Karin Krog, the renowned Norwegian jazz vocalist, invites you into her world with "Two of a Kind," a captivating vocal jazz album released on January 1, 1982, under Meantime Records. Spanning just under 47 minutes, this album is a testament to Krog's velvety voice and her ability to breathe new life into both classic and lesser-known songs.
The tracklist is a delightful mix of standards and hidden gems, showcasing Krog's versatility and musical prowess. From the playful "Jeepers Creepers" to the tender "The Touch of Your Lips," and the joyous "Halleluja I Love Him So," each song is a masterclass in vocal jazz. Krog's interpretation of "Ain't Nobody's Business" and her rendition of "Cabin in the Sky" are particularly noteworthy, highlighting her ability to infuse each track with her unique charm and emotional depth.
